How does army command sponsorship work?

In simple terms, if your Soldier is granted Command Sponsorship of dependents, this means: Your new duty station has the educational and medical resources to support your family’s needs. Your family is authorized a fully funded move and is approved to accompany your Soldier overseas.

How long is command sponsorship?

Soldiers who are approved for Command Sponsorship must complete a 3-year accompanied tour in USAREUR, which starts on the day Command Sponsorship is approved.

What happens if command sponsorship is denied?

If command sponsorship is denied, you will receive “unaccompanied orders.” Your family members may still be able to move to your PCS host country, but be aware that you will be responsible for all transportation, moving and living expenses associated with their move.

What does it mean to be command sponsored?

Being granted Command Sponsorship means that your family members are approved to accompany a DoD member “Outside the Continental U.S.” (OCONUS) for the length of his or her tour. Command Sponsorship of dependents is not guaranteed.

What is command sponsored dependent?

A COMMAND-SPONSORED Dependent is a Dependent residing with a member at an OCONUS location at which an accompanied-by-dependents tour is authorized, the member is authorized to serve that tour, and who is authorized by the appropriate authority to be at the member’s Permanent Duty Station.

What is the Total Army sponsorship Program?

The Total Army Sponsorship Program, or TASP, mission is to help Soldiers, civilian employees and their families better integrate into the U.S. Army, and to assist them when they transition to different units.

What qualifies you for EFMP?

Enrollment in the EFMP is mandatory for active duty service members who have dependent family members with ongoing medical, mental health, or special educational needs.

Will the military pay for my spouse to move?

The good news is that the military will pay for your spouse to move as long as you live in the same home together. Depending on the amount of leave you have, your spouse may be the one making most of the moving arrangements.

What does sponsor mean on military ID?

Sponsorship & Eligibility The sponsor is the person affiliated with the DoD or other federal agency who takes responsibility for verifying and authorizing the applicant’s need for an ID card.

What is military sponsorship?

Sponsors are trained service members who help newcomers settle into a new duty station. They are available to all military families, no matter where you are moving.
